#4d50ac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4d50ac is composed of 30.2% red, 31.4%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.2% cyan, 53.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 238.1 degrees, a saturation of 38.2% and a lightness of 48.8%. #4d50ac color hex could be obtained by blending #9aa0ff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#4d50ac

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040409 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d50ac

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737486 is the less saturated color, while #0008f9 is the most saturated one.
